What AC Unit Should You Get?

Split AC

Units are connected by a pipe. They’re also more costly to run than other types of ACs in terms of maintenance.

Window AC

Window ACs are simpler than split ACs, don’t need as much space for installation, and all components come in one unit. This installation and uninstallation of a window AC are easier and cheaper. If you live in a rented house and move often, then this might be the best type of air conditioner for you since it will cause less hassle.

Window ACElectric window ACs is designed to fill a certain amount of space and keep the room cooler by blowing warm or cold air on an adjacent surface. They also block the window opening, which means that you can’t open it. Because they’re so loud, they might be a poor option for very large rooms.

Portable AC

Portable air conditioners are more convenient to change rooms than window ACs. They function similarly, but can be picked up and transported. These type of units come with an attached hose; one end is connected to the machine while the other needs to be placed outside a window opening.

Portable air conditioners have rose in popularity due to people wanting to save money by not having to buy two AC units. Even though portable ACs are noisier and slightly more expensive, they suffice for smaller rooms.

Why is an AC’s Warranty and Service Quality Important?

The compressor is arguably the most important part of any AC unit, so its repair costs are usually higher than other parts. Make sure to pay attention to how long of a warranty period the company offers on their compressors. The length of compressor warranties varies among brands, with some offering as little as three years and premium brands offering up to ten.

Here Are Some Extra Features To Keep In Mind While You’re Buying An AC.

Auto Start

Something to keep in mind for the next time there’s a power outage: some air conditioners don’t restart automatically. If your AC has an Auto Start feature, though, it will turn itself back on after the power comes back and adjust the temperature to what it was before everything went dark.

Dehumidification

All ACs work to reduce the humidity in a room while also cooling it, though some have an extra dehumidification feature that helps even more if you live somewhere with high humidity levels.

Four-Way Swing

Inverter-Split-ACMany air conditioners come with a two-way swing to help distribute air more evenly throughout the room. While it doesnÔÇÖt have much of an effect on how well the AC actually cools the space, it does make a difference in how you perceive the temperature since cold air will be flowing past you regularly.

Some AC units even have four-way swings, which means they can blow air horizontally and vertically. This is handy if you need specific airflow in one area of the room.

Sleep Timer

The sleep timer function allows you to keep the AC running for a set period of time, then it will automatically turn off. This way, you’re not wasting power by keeping the AC on all night, and you don’t have to wake up in the middle of the night to turn it off yourself.

These functions allow acs to be linked to your smartphone or online service, allowing you to manage the AC from anywhere in the house or even if you’re not there. You can also use voice commands on your smartphone or smart speaker’s voice assistant to operate the AC.┬á

Depending on the price and brand, certain ACs can automatically turn on when specific conditions are met. For example, some models will kick into gear when they sense you’re close to your home, making sure it’s at your ideal temperature by the time you arrive.

Turbo Mode

Though most brands market this features under a different name, turning it on will make the AC run at full capacity to cool the room down faster.

The Most Commonly Used Gimmicks to Avoid

Mosquito Repellent Feature

Mosquitoes are attracted to some brands’ air conditioners, which have a mosquito-repellent feature. You could be tempted by this characteristic in places like India, where there are more mosquitos.

Anti-Bacteria

Some companies claim that their air conditioner filters eliminate hazardous germs. Some businesses may even state that carbon dioxide filtering AC filters are capable of removing the COVID-19 virus during this epidemic.┬áHowever, it’s difficult to assess the efficacy of features like this because most people can’t test them in practice. As a result, don’t select an air conditioner based on this capability.
